North Slope/South Slope, High Uintas East
Description
Duchesne, Summit, and Uintah counties—Boundary begins where the Uinta River crosses the USFS boundary; then north along the Uinta River to USFS Trail 044 near Painter Basin; west on this trail to USFS Trail 068; north on this trail to Gunsight Pass and USFS Trail 117; north on this trail to the Henrys Fork River; north along this river to the Utah-Wyoming state line; east on this state line to the USFS boundary; south and east on the USFS boundary to SR-44; west along SR-44 to Carter Creek; west along this creek to Brownie Lake and Weyman Creek; south along this creek to USFS Trail 019 in Weyman Park; south on this trail over an unnamed pass to USFS Trail 025; west on this trail to Whiterocks Lake and the Whiterocks River; south along this river to the USFS boundary; west on this boundary to the Uinta River. USGS 1:100,000 Maps: Dutch John, Kings Peak. Boundary questions? Call the Vernal office, 435-781-9459, or the Ogden office, 801-476-2740.
